list-city-weather
Lists the weather of cities
#Requires -Version 5.1
function List-City-Weather {
$cities = @("Hawaii","Los Angeles","Mexico City","Dallas","Miami","New York","Rio de Janeiro","Paris","London","Berlin","Cape Town","Dubai","Mumbai","Singapore","Hong Kong","Perth","Peking","Tokyo","Sydney")
foreach($city in $cities) {
$icon = (Invoke-WebRequest http://wttr.in/${City}?format="%c" -UserAgent "curl" -useBasicParsing).Content
$temp = (Invoke-WebRequest http://wttr.in/${City}?format="%t" -UserAgent "curl" -useBasicParsing).Content
$rain = (Invoke-WebRequest http://wttr.in/${City}?format="%p %h" -UserAgent "curl" -useBasicParsing).Content
$wind = (Invoke-WebRequest http://wttr.in/${City}?format="%w" -UserAgent "curl" -useBasicParsing).Content
$sun = (Invoke-WebRequest http://wttr.in/${City}?format="%S → %s" -UserAgent "curl" -useBasicParsing).Content
New-Object PSObject -Property @{ Timestamp = (Get-Date -Format "yyyy-MM-dd HH:mm:ss"); CITY="$city $icon"; TEMP=$temp; RAIN=$rain; WIND=$wind; SUN=$sun }
}
}
try {
List-City-Weather | Format-Table -property @{e='CITY';width=19},@{e='TEMP';width=9},@{e='RAIN';width=14},@{e='WIND';width=12},@{e='SUN';width=20}
exit 0
} catch {
throw
}This script has no configurable parameters.
